On November 2, Li Mingyong, director of the Forestry and Grassland Bureau of Qujing City, led a research team to Puli Township to investigate industrial development and rural revitalization.

The research team went to the Gott Ecological Tea Garden to check the development of the ancient tree tea industry, to the channel project construction base and the thornless pepper seedling base to check the project construction, and to learn more about the scale of industrial development, infrastructure construction, grass-roots party building, and rural civilization.
